LONDON WOOL PROSPECTS
QUANTITIES NOT EXCESSIVE. By Telegraph—Presa Assn.—Copyright. Rec. 6.30 p.m. London, Nov. 19. Mr. Devereux, representative of Australian wool interests, reports that there is little change in the wool markets. The offerings are not excessive, and this should strengthen the prices at the opening of the sales next week. Bradford export tops continue to be satisfactory and Merinos are firm.
